What Is Invisalign and How Does It Work?

Invisalign is an orthodontic system that uses a series of custom-made, transparent plastic aligners to gradually shift your teeth into their ideal positions. Unlike traditional braces with metal brackets and wires, these clear aligners are virtually invisible and can be removed for eating and cleaning.

Custom Treatment Planning: Your dentist uses advanced 3D imaging technology to create a precise digital model of your teeth and map out the exact movements needed to achieve your ideal smile. This digital treatment plan allows you to see a preview of your results before you even begin.

Sequential Aligner System: You'll receive a series of aligner trays, each slightly different from the last. You wear each set for about one to two weeks before progressing to the next set in the series. Each aligner applies gentle, controlled pressure to specific teeth, moving them incrementally toward their final positions.

Benefits of Choosing Clear Aligners Over Traditional Braces

Invisalign offers numerous advantages that make it an appealing choice for both teens and adults seeking orthodontic treatment in Georgetown.

  • Nearly invisible appearance allows you to straighten your teeth discreetly without feeling self-conscious about your smile during treatment
  • Removable design means you can take out the aligners for meals, allowing you to enjoy all your favorite foods without dietary restrictions
  • Easy oral hygiene maintenance since you can brush and floss normally without navigating around brackets and wires
  • More comfortable than traditional braces with no metal components to irritate your cheeks or gums
  • Fewer dental appointments required compared to traditional braces, as there are no wires to tighten or brackets to adjust
  • Predictable treatment timeline with a clear view of your expected results from the beginning

Signs You May Be a Good Candidate for Invisalign

Many common orthodontic concerns can be effectively addressed with clear aligner therapy. Consider Invisalign treatment if you experience any of these dental alignment issues.

  • Crowded teeth that overlap or twist due to insufficient space in your jaw
  • Gaps or spaces between your teeth that affect your smile appearance and oral health
  • Overbite where your upper front teeth extend too far over your lower teeth
  • Underbite where your lower teeth protrude in front of your upper teeth
  • Crossbite where some upper teeth sit inside your lower teeth when your mouth is closed
  • Open bite where your upper and lower teeth don't meet when your mouth is closed

During your comprehensive dental exam, your dentist will evaluate your specific orthodontic needs and determine whether Invisalign is the right solution for your situation.

The Invisalign Treatment Process in Georgetown

Understanding what to expect throughout your clear aligner journey can help you feel confident about beginning treatment.

1. Initial Consultation and Assessment

Your treatment begins with a thorough evaluation where your dentist examines your teeth, discusses your smile goals, and takes digital impressions or scans of your mouth. This appointment is essential for determining whether Invisalign can address your specific orthodontic concerns.

2. Custom Treatment Plan Development

Using advanced 3D imaging technology, your dentist creates a personalized treatment plan that maps out the precise movement of your teeth from their current positions to their ideal alignment. You'll be able to see a digital preview of how your smile will look after completing treatment.

3. Receiving Your Custom Aligners

Once your custom aligners are fabricated, you'll return to pick them up and receive detailed instructions on how to wear and care for them. You'll typically receive several sets at once, with guidance on when to switch to each new aligner in the series.

4. Wearing Your Aligners Daily

For optimal results, you'll need to wear your aligners for 20 to 22 hours per day, removing them only for eating, drinking anything other than water, and cleaning your teeth. Consistent wear ensures your teeth move according to the treatment plan timeline.

5. Regular Progress Monitoring

You'll have periodic check-in appointments every six to eight weeks so your dentist can monitor your progress, ensure your teeth are moving as planned, and provide you with your next sets of aligners. These appointments are typically shorter and less frequent than traditional braces adjustments.

Maintaining Your Smile During and After Invisalign Treatment

Proper care of your aligners and teeth throughout treatment ensures the best possible results and protects your oral health.

  • Clean Your Aligners Daily: Rinse your aligners with lukewarm water and gently brush them with a soft toothbrush to remove bacteria and prevent discoloration. Avoid using hot water, which can warp the plastic.
  • Maintain Excellent Oral Hygiene: Brush and floss your teeth after every meal before reinserting your aligners to prevent trapping food particles and bacteria against your teeth, which could lead to decay or gum problems.
  • Store Aligners Properly: Always place your aligners in their protective case when not wearing them to prevent loss, damage, or contamination. Never wrap them in a napkin, as they can easily be mistaken for trash.
  • Avoid Staining Substances: Remove your aligners before consuming coffee, tea, red wine, or other beverages that could stain the clear plastic or discolor your teeth.
  • Wear Your Retainer After Treatment: Once your teeth reach their ideal positions, you'll need to wear a retainer as directed to maintain your new smile and prevent your teeth from gradually shifting back toward their original positions.
